Delivered in 2000, Gitan is a 30.85m motor yacht built by Italian shipyard Admiral Yachts. Her naval architecture and exterior design comes from the drawing boards of Admiral Yachts, while Laura Baldoni de Gorga is responsible for her interior design.
Design & Construction
Designed around a planing aluminium hull and superstructure she features a 7.1m beam and a 2.3m draft. The yacht is built over 2 decks with an internal volume of 186 GT (Gross Tonnes).
Accommodation
Gitan offers accommodation for up to 10 guests in 5 suites comprising an owners cabin and 4 twin cabins. She is also capable of carrying up to 6 crew onboard to ensure a relaxed luxury yacht experience.
Performance & Capabilities
Powered by twin diesel MTU (12V 396 TE 94) 2,283hp engines, motor yacht Gitan is capable of reaching a top speed of 31 knots, and comfortably cruises at 28 knots. With her 22,200 litre fuel tanks she has a maximum range of 1,152 nautical miles at 28 knots. Her planing hull design means she is fast and efficient as she slices through the water.
